1. The computation of the loom operator's compensation for the week is $736 ($16 x 40 + $24 x 4).
2. The calculation of the employee's total overtime premium for the week is $32 ($8 x 4).
3. The amount of the employee's total compensation for the week that is direct-labor cost is $704 ($16 x 44).
4) The amount of the employee's total compensation for the week that is overhead is $32 ($8 x 4).
Data and Calculations:
Earnings per hour = $16
Overtime rate = $24
Overtime premium = $8 ($24 - $16)
Number of hours worked = 44 hours
Normal work hours = 40 hours
Thus, loom operator earns a total of $736 per week with an overtime premium of $32.
